Common Interpretation
Encountering a judge invading your home in a dream often symbolizes a profound feeling of being judged or scrutinized in your personal life. The home represents your safe haven, so its invasion by a figure of authority signals that boundaries you believed were secure feel compromised. This could relate to real-life experiences of criticism, accountability, or confronting uncomfortable truths from someone in power or your own internal moral compass. Emotionally, this dream may carry anxiety, defenselessness, or the need to reassess how you balance external expectations with your private identity. The judge embodies fairness or law, suggesting that you might be wrestling with ethics, guilt, or seeking justice within yourself or your relationships. It’s a prompt to examine where you feel invaded or unfairly judged and consider setting stronger boundaries or facing unresolved issues.

Psychological Significance
From a psychological standpoint, this dream can represent internal conflicts about authority, self-worth, and control. It might emerge when you feel dominated by external pressures or your own inner critic imposing harsh rules. Therapists might see it as a projection of anxiety around imposter syndrome, moral dilemmas, or fear of exposure. The house symbolizes the psyche, so an invasion signals a perceived threat to your psychological safety, encouraging reflection on where you can regain control or forgiveness.
